Prunus dulcis (fruiting almond) ‘Hall’s Hardy Flowering’
[gallery ids="7324,8185"]
A late blooming, vigorous growing tree. The flowers are profuse, and dark pink. The nut is more bitter than the commercial varieties. It is self-fruitful. (800 hours chilling). Almonds need full sun and a well-drained soil....

Prunus (fruiting cherry) ‘Lapins’
[gallery ids="8292"]
A large, firm, dark-red, sweet cherry, similar to Bing. It ripens mid-season and is self-fertile. (800 hours chilling). Fruiting cherries do best in full sun and a well-drained soil. Avoid heavy clay soils and soils with poor drainage....

Prunus (fruiting cherry) ‘Black Tartarian’
A firm purplish-black sweet cherry. The flesh is dark red, juicy and very rich. The fruit is smaller than Bing, and just as flavorful. Needs a pollinizer. (900 hours chilling). Fruiting cherries do best in full sun and a well-drained soil. Avoid heavy clay soils and soils with poor drainage....
